How can I protect my cryptocurrency from hacking attacks?

- RK Lifecare INCJun 28, 2022 · 3 years agoAs a cryptocurrency investor, it's crucial to prioritize the security of your digital assets. Here are a few strategies to protect your cryptocurrency from hacking attacks: 1. Use a hardware wallet: Hardware wallets provide an extra layer of security by keeping your private keys offline. This makes it extremely difficult for hackers to gain access to your funds. 2. Enable two-factor authentication (2FA): Implementing 2FA adds an extra step to the login process, making it more challenging for hackers to breach your accounts. 3. Keep your software up to date: Regularly update your cryptocurrency wallets and software to ensure you have the latest security patches. 4. Be cautious of phishing attempts: Avoid clicking on suspicious links or providing personal information to unknown sources. 5. Use strong and unique passwords: Create complex passwords and avoid reusing them across multiple platforms. Remember, the security of your cryptocurrency is in your hands. Stay vigilant and take proactive measures to protect your digital assets.
- Makafui DeynuJun 23, 2021 · 4 years agoHey there! If you want to keep your cryptocurrency safe from hacking attacks, here are a few tips for you: 1. Don't keep all your eggs in one basket: Diversify your cryptocurrency holdings across different wallets and exchanges to minimize the risk of losing everything in case of a hack. 2. Educate yourself: Stay informed about the latest security practices and common hacking techniques to better protect your assets. 3. Consider using a VPN: A virtual private network (VPN) can add an extra layer of security by encrypting your internet connection. 4. Be wary of public Wi-Fi: Avoid accessing your cryptocurrency accounts or making transactions while connected to public Wi-Fi networks, as they may be vulnerable to hacking. Stay safe and happy hodling!
